The Lifecycle of a Medical Implant Device
The journey of a medical implant device is a complex and multifaceted process that encompasses multiple stages, from initial ideation to eventual insertion. The first stage involves rigorous research and formulation of the device concept, driven by implanted medical term a deep understanding of clinical needs and patient outcomes.
Subsequent stages include meticulous design to ensure both safety and biocompatibility. Thorough testing protocols, encompassing both in vitro and in vivo experiments, are crucial to validate the device's functionality.
Once a device successfully completes these validation steps, it progresses through regulatory authorizations before reaching the market. Ongoing surveillance and tracking are vital to ensure long-term safety and efficacy in real-world clinical settings.

Challenges and Opportunities in Medical Implant Development
The sector of medical implant development presents a unique set of challenges and prospects. While the potential to improve patient lives is immense, developers face stringent regulatory hurdles, the need for cellular integration, and the sophistication of designing implants that can perform reliably within the human body. Despite these barriers, advancements in materials science, manufacturing techniques, and our knowledge of biological systems are paving the way for pioneering implant solutions.
